Output 74f5fec69b4c84c33143b67a8226d359ea8b660f73ee21c8694eedd71cc3ac1a:0

value
2759630
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3095feffc1bb3ed4cbcd07078b1fd6849c914059 OP_EQUALVERIFY OP_CHECKSIG
address
15Ru87tzg5AerX4ZRYsYHbFreuSntp2UAn
transaction
74f5fec69b4c84c33143b67a8226d359ea8b660f73ee21c8694eedd71cc3ac1a
spent
true